引言
物理力学是物理学的一个重要分支,涉及物体在力的作用下的运动规律。对于初学者来说,物理力学中的一些难题可能会让人感到困惑。本文将详细解析几个经典例题,帮助读者掌握物理力学的计算技巧。
经典例题一:自由落体运动
问题
一物体从高度h自由落体,不计空气阻力,求落地时的速度v。
解题步骤
确定已知量和未知量
- 已知量:高度h,重力加速度g(取9.8 m/s²)
- 未知量:速度v
应用公式
- 根据自由落体运动的公式:v² = u² + 2as
- u为初速度(此处为0)
- a为加速度(此处为g)
- s为位移(此处为h)
- 根据自由落体运动的公式:v² = u² + 2as
代入公式计算 “`python
定义已知量
h = 10 # 高度,单位:米 g = 9.8 # 重力加速度,单位:米/秒²²
# 计算速度 v = (02 + 2 * g * h)0.5 print(“落地时的速度v为:”, v, “米/秒”)
### 结果分析
运行上述代码,得到落地时的速度v约为14.14米/秒。
## 经典例题二:抛体运动
### 问题
一物体以初速度v₀水平抛出,不计空气阻力,求物体落地时的水平位移x。
### 解题步骤
1. **确定已知量和未知量**
- 已知量:初速度v₀,时间t,重力加速度g
- 未知量:水平位移x
2. **应用公式**
- 水平位移公式:x = v₀ * t
- 时间公式:t = v₀ / g
3. **代入公式计算**
```python
# 定义已知量
v0 = 10 # 水平初速度,单位:米/秒
g = 9.8 # 重力加速度,单位:米/秒²
# 计算时间
t = v0 / g
# 计算水平位移
x = v0 * t
print("物体落地时的水平位移x为:", x, "米")
结果分析
运行上述代码,得到物体落地时的水平位移x约为10.2米。
经典例题三:牛顿第三定律
问题
一物体A以速度v₁向物体B撞击,物体B静止。求撞击后两物体的速度。
解题步骤
确定已知量和未知量
- 已知量:物体A的质量m₁,速度v₁;物体B的质量m₂
- 未知量:撞击后物体A和B的速度v₁’和v₂’
应用公式
- 根据牛顿第三定律:F₁ = -F₂
- 动量守恒:m₁v₁ + m₂v₂ = m₁v₁’ + m₂v₂’
代入公式计算 “`python
定义已知量
m1 = 1 # 物体A的质量,单位:千克 m2 = 2 # 物体B的质量,单位:千克 v1 = 5 # 物体A的速度,单位:米/秒
# 计算撞击后速度 v1_prime = (m1 - m2) * v1 / (m1 + m2) v2_prime = (2 * m1 * v1) / (m1 + m2) print(“撞击后物体A的速度v₁’为:”, v1_prime, “米/秒”) print(“撞击后物体B的速度v₂’为:”, v2_prime, “米/秒”) “`
结果分析
运行上述代码,得到撞击后物体A的速度v₁’约为-2.22米/秒,物体B的速度v₂’约为6.67米/秒。
总结
本文通过详细解析三个经典例题,帮助读者掌握了物理力学的计算技巧。在解决物理力学问题时,关键在于熟悉相关公式,并灵活运用这些公式进行计算。希望读者通过学习和实践,能够更好地掌握物理力学的知识。
